Adobe merging units serving PCs, Web, mobile phones and consumer electronics
Software giant Adobe has said that they are now merging their units which are selling software to design programs for PCs, Web, mobile devices and consumer electronics.
This is just another step in their consolidation process after they merged with rival company Macromedia few years ago.
The company added that its mobile and devices business unit would now join their experience and technology group led by Adobe Chief Technology Officer Kevin Lynch.
Lynch came to Adobe from Macromedia where he was an executive level employee.
